Hotel Boulderado Review

The gracious lobby of this elegant 1909 beauty has a soaring stained-glass ceiling, and the mezzanine beckons with romantic nooks galore. When choosing a room, opt for the old building, with spacious quarters filled with period antiques and reproductions. The new wing is plush and comfortable but has less Victorian character. Rooms with mountain views are available on request. The hotel has two restaurants: Q's ($$$$) offers upscale dining, while the Corner Bar ($-$$) serves less formal lunch and dinner. Downstairs, the Catacombs Blues Bar is always hopping, and has live music three nights a week. Guests have access to the nearby health club, One Boulder Fitness.
